#f4a9f4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f4a9f4 is composed of 95.7% red, 66.3% green and 95.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 30.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 300 degrees, a saturation of 77.3% and a lightness of 81%. #f4a9f4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#e953e9. Closest websafe color is: #ff99ff.

● #f4a9f4 color description : Very soft magenta.
#f4a9f4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f4a9f4 has RGB values of R:244, G:169, B:244 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.31, Y:0,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16034292.

Shades and Tints of #f4a9f4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010001 is the darkest color, while #fdeffd is the lightest one.

Tones of #f4a9f4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#cfcecf is the less saturated color, while #fba2fb is the most saturated one.
